in the USABowie State University is a small public
HBCU college with some focus on psychology programs and located in
Bowie,
Maryland. The college was opened in 1865 and is presently offering bachelor's, certificates, and master's degrees in 6 psychology programs.
Bowie State University is a little bit expensive: tuition is about $21,000 per year. If you are looking for a cheaper alternative, check
